Fort Oglethorpe, GA is a quaint town located in northern Georgia, near the border of Tennessee. With a population of approximately 9,000 residents, it offers a small-town feel with the convenience of being close to larger cities like Chattanooga. The community is made up of a diverse range of individuals, including families, retirees, and young professionals, creating a welcoming and inclusive atmosphere.
The climate in Fort Oglethorpe is characterized by mild winters and hot summers, making it an ideal location for those who enjoy a mix of seasons. The town is rich in history, having served as an important military site during both the Civil War and World War I. Visitors can explore sites like the Chickamauga and Chattanooga National Military Park, which offer a glimpse into the area's past and its significance in American history.
